Transaction 3577521538b380fceb19362569e4b7e83d0d22c7a82480405bd1891d459f909a
1 Input
1 Output
-
3577521538b380fceb19362569e4b7e83d0d22c7a82480405bd1891d459f909a:0
- value
- 31923362
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e68f9ee3dfada38d6e73189965b5b5654fcabcc OP_EQUALVERIFY OP_CHECKSIG
- address
- 16gzemu3gyjfgfXCL3Vv8sLjqRAizvoEcm